The Nova Titans will take on the Pembroke Pines Charter Jaguars at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The two teams have had a bumpy ride up to this point with three consecutive losses for Nova and five for Pembroke Pines Charter.
Nova is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They took a 30-15 bruising from Hallandale on Friday.
Meanwhile, Pembroke Pines Charter fell victim to Miramar and their airtight defense on Friday. They were outmatched by the Patriots and fell 39-0. While losing is never fun, the Jaguars can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ida football rankings (they are ranked 452nd, while the Patriots are ranked 139th).
Nova's defeat dropped their record down to 1-4. As for Pembroke Pines Charter, their loss dropped their record down to 1-5.
Nova and Pembroke Pines Charter were almost perfectly matched up in their previous meeting back in October of 2024, but Nova suffered an agonizing 29-28 defeat. Thankfully for the Titans, Keidran Willis Jr (who rushed for 104 yards and one TD, and also picked up 64 receiving yards and one touchdown) won't be suiting up this time.
